Types of Furniture Suitable for Storage
Almost any type of furniture can be placed into storage if it is prepared correctly. This makes furniture storage in Uxbridge useful for a wide variety of households and organisations. The key is understanding which items need special care and how to prepare them before they are moved.
Common furniture items stored in Uxbridge include sofas, armchairs, beds, mattresses, wardrobes, tables, chairs, shelves, bookcases, cabinets, sideboards, coffee tables, and outdoor furniture. Office furniture such as desks, filing cabinets, storage cupboards, meeting tables, and reception seating is also frequently stored during relocations or redesigns.
Some items require extra attention. For example, wooden furniture can be sensitive to moisture and temperature changes. Upholstered items may need protection from dust and odours. Glass tabletops and mirrored furniture need careful wrapping and placement. Antique furniture, meanwhile, may require especially gentle handling due to age, finish, or sentimental value.
Furniture that benefits most from careful storage
- Wooden furniture: Needs protection from humidity and scratches.
- Fabric sofas and chairs: Should be wrapped to reduce dust exposure.
- Mattresses: Need clean, dry storage and proper covering.
- Antique and vintage pieces: Require extra care to prevent surface damage.
- Office items: Benefit from organised storage for future use.

How to Prepare Furniture for Storage
Good preparation is one of the most important parts of successful furniture storage in Uxbridge. Even the best storage unit cannot fully protect items if they are moved in dirty, damp, or poorly packed. Taking time to prepare furniture properly will help preserve its condition and make future retrieval much easier.
Start by cleaning each item thoroughly. Dust, crumbs, spills, and moisture can cause problems over time. Wooden surfaces should be wiped and dried. Fabric items should be vacuumed. If possible, let everything air out before wrapping or packing. This reduces the chance of trapped moisture, which can lead to mould or unpleasant smells.
Next, disassemble large furniture where possible. Removing table legs, bed frames, and shelving parts makes pieces easier to transport and store. Keep screws, bolts, and small fittings in labelled bags so that reassembly is simple later. Use protective materials such as blankets, covers, bubble wrap, and stretch wrap to guard against scratches and dust.
Preparation tips that save time later
- Take photos before disassembly so reassembly is easier.
- Label every part and bag of fittings clearly.
- Wrap fragile corners and edges carefully.
- Use pallets or risers where appropriate to keep items off the floor.
- Avoid overpacking items into one unit.

Making the Most of Your Storage Space
Once your furniture is in storage, organisation becomes important. Smart placement can help you use the space effectively and make retrieval much easier. If you are storing multiple items, think about what you may need first and place those items near the front. Heavier items should be stacked safely, while lighter or fragile items should be placed where they will not be crushed.
Labeling is another useful habit. Mark boxes, covers, and furniture parts clearly so that everything is easy to identify later. Keep a simple inventory list if you are storing several pieces. That way, you can track what is inside the unit without opening everything each time you visit.
When possible, leave a walkway inside the unit. This makes it easier to access items without moving everything around. It also helps reduce accidental damage. Good organisation turns furniture storage in Uxbridge into a more convenient and efficient experience.
Simple space-saving strategies
- Store items vertically when safe to do so.
- Use protective covers rather than loose wrapping.
- Place frequently needed items near the door.
- Break down large pieces to save space.
- Keep an inventory of everything stored.
